Q: How does the Larkspell support team get in at night? A: Main doors at Fenholt Tower lock at 21:00. Night-shift staff enter via the east vestibule only. Check names against the rota pinned behind the desk before buzzing anyone through. Escort contractors; staff go alone. The vestibule keypad resets monthly — current entry code is below.

door code, yagap-bahof: bdg-O-05

**Leadership Review Briefing: Large-Deal Discount Policy**

This briefing summarises the proposed discount framework for deals above the enterprise threshold. Standard discounts remain capped at 15%; deals exceeding that require sign-off from the pricing committee, with documented justification. Early analysis by the Marrowgate team suggests disciplined discounting improves renewal margins. The underlying commercial reasoning is set out below.

board note of bajop-yaweg: The western region missed its Pelys quota by 58.0 percent last quarter. Pelysek Foods plans to raise the Belius list price by 44.0 percent in July. The steering committee signed off on a budget of $133.8 million for Project Pelax. The renewal with Zoraelix Systems closes at $61.9 million a year, 12.7 percent above the last contract.

- [ ] **Step 7: Breaker override escrow.** After sealing the signing keys for the Tallgrove upstream API circuit breaker, confirm the support team can force the breaker open during a full outage. The override bundle lives in the sealed escrow drawer and is useless without its unlock phrase. Two ceremony witnesses must initial this step before proceeding. The escrow bundle is decrypted with the recovery passphrase that follows.

vault phrase of kahip-kahop = holath-quenmir

Quick note on the Fleetlet driver-assignment heuristic: we score each candidate driver by weighted distance, idle time, and recent decline rate, then pick the max. Nothing fancy — greedy per request, no batching yet. Tiebreaks go to longer idle time so nobody starves. The weights came out of a week of replay sims on Harborton data. Current tuning constants are below.

tuning table, hafog-bahaf:
QUOTAS = {
    "praion": 144,
    "briax": 906,
    "silwyn": 451,
}